What's interesting is how the league came to the decision to put them in the NFC east origionally. In 1960 there were conspiracy theories involving top Dallas officials along with former comissioner Pete Rozelle to put Dallas in the NFC east because in so doing at the time felt it would give them the best opportunity to be successful. Tex Schramm who headed the Cowboys at the time had hired Pete Rozelle as his PR man in LA before moving to Texas. The stage had been set for Dallas to become a league darling, and it continued up to the point where they have been refered to as "America's Team". They were an interesting group from the time they entered the league because they were playing computerized football in 1960. However, their games with the Redskins were just an afterthought until George Allen arrived and the true rivalry began. |
